Fastest Route: Taking I-270 N and I-70 W
The fastest way to get from Bethesda to Martinsburg is to take I-270 N and then switch onto I-70 W. This route covers a distance of approximately 65 miles and typically takes about one hour to complete. However, keep in mind that traffic conditions can greatly impact your travel time. During peak traffic times, such as weekday mornings and evenings, it may take a bit longer to reach your destination.
Slowest Route: Taking US-340 W
For a more scenic drive, you can opt for the slower route via US-340 W. This route spans around 70 miles and usually takes around one and a half hours to complete. Although it may take a bit longer, the picturesque views along this route make it well worth considering. Just be aware that during peak traffic times, like rush hour or holiday weekends, the travel time can be even longer.
